Mbanza-Ngungu in Spring
In spring (September, October and November), Mbanza-Ngungu sees average daytime highs around 28°C and overnight lows near 20°C, with 353 mm of rain over about 50 wet days across the season. It is the 3rd-warmest season and the 3rd-wettest season.
Across spring, daytime highs hold fairly steady around 28°C.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 2% of the time across spring, and the air most often feels muggy.

Temperature in Mbanza-Ngungu in Spring
Across spring, daytime highs hold fairly steady around 28°C.
A typical spring day in Mbanza-Ngungu reaches about 28°C and drops to 20°C overnight. The warmest of the three months is October, the coolest September.

Mbanza-Ngungu weather by month
How the three spring months (September, October and November) compare with the rest of the year — the season's months are highlighted.
| Month | High / Low (°C) | Rainfall (mm) | Wet days | Daylight (hours) | Travel score |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Jan | 29° / 21° | 154 | 23 | 12.3 | 3.8 |
| Feb | 29° / 21° | 114 | 18 | 12.2 | 3.9 |
| Mar | 30° / 21° | 147 | 20.7 | 12 | 3.7 |
| Apr | 30° / 21° | 201 | 25 | 11.9 | 3.2 |
| May | 28° / 21° | 95 | 16.4 | 11.8 | 4.9 |
| Jun | 27° / 19° | 4 | 0.8 | 11.7 | 7.8 |
| Jul | 26° / 18° | 1 | 0.1 | 11.7 | 8.0 |
| Aug | 27° / 18° | 6 | 1.4 | 11.8 | 7.5 |
| Sep | 28° / 20° | 18 | 5.3 | 12 | 6.5 |
| Oct | 29° / 21° | 113 | 18.3 | 12.1 | 4.4 |
| Nov | 29° / 21° | 222 | 25.9 | 12.2 | 3.4 |
| Dec | 28° / 21° | 205 | 26.8 | 12.3 | 3.5 |

UV index in Mbanza-Ngungu in Spring
Clear-sky midday UV across spring averages around 11 (very high — sun protection essential). The full-year curve, shaded by WHO exposure level, is below.
Under clear skies, the midday UV index in Mbanza-Ngungu peaks around March 17 at about 15 (extreme) — sunscreen, a hat and midday shade are essential. It bottoms out near August 11 at about 6 (high).
The index reaches 3 or more — the level where the WHO recommends sun protection — every month of the year.

Air quality in Mbanza-Ngungu in Spring
Average fine-particle pollution (PM2.5) through the year — so you can see where spring falls, not just the annual average.
Air quality in Mbanza-Ngungu is worst in July — around 61 µg/m³ PM2.5 (unhealthy), about 3.6× the cleanest month (November, 17 µg/m³).
Modeled monthly averages (CAMS reanalysis, 2015–2024).

Where is Mbanza-Ngungu?
Mbanza-Ngungu sits at 5.3°S, 14.9°E, 735 m above sea level, in Democratic Republic of the Congo. The nearest listed city is Inkisi, 26 km away.
Topography around Mbanza-Ngungu
How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Mbanza-Ngungu.
Within 3 km, the terrain around Mbanza-Ngungu has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 192 m around an average of 684 m above sea level; within 16 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 426 m; within 80 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 754 m.
The land around Mbanza-Ngungu is covered by grassland (35%), trees (22%) and artificial surfaces (21%) within 3 km, grassland (55%) and trees (24%) within 16 km, and grassland (64%) and trees (26%) within 80 km.
